The University of West Florida is hiring a Director of Sponsored Research. This role involves collaborating with researchers to identify funding, organize projects, oversee grant proposal development, and ensure compliance and successful execution of awarded research projects while fostering interdisciplinary collaboration and managing research administration compliance.

Highlights
  • Liaise with researchers to identify funding opportunities and organize research projects.
  • Lead grant proposal development, submission, and compliance management.
  • Manage execution, financial oversight, and closeouts of awarded projects.
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and university regulations including Uniform Guidance (2 CFR Part 200).
  • Provide mentorship and training to pre-award and post-award research administration staff.
  • Collaborate with academic departments, research centers, and administrative offices to support research activities.
  • Required qualifications include a master's degree with six years of experience or a bachelor's with eight years, with a preference for a doctoral degree in STEM or health sciences.
  • Experience as a principal investigator on federally or state-funded research and grant writing skills are essential.
  • Knowledge of grant portals (Grants.gov, NSF Research.gov, eRA Commons) and financial principles in research administration.
  • Preferred skills include experience with Tableau, Ellucian Banner Document Management System, and leadership experience.
